Trip

Perched on the edge of Santa Monica, Trip is indeed a trip. From the outside, it looks like an everyday neighborhood bar, but the club is actually one of the Westside's leading hot spots, with nightly no-cover live music, comedy and burlesque.

The Redwood Bar & Grill

A longtime haunt for politicians and journalists, this downtown bar hosts an endless parade of punks and roots rockers on its small, low stage, set against a festively nautical backdrop of fishing nets and mermaid paintings.

The Satellite

Once known as Spaceland and, before that, Pan, this Silver Lake bar continues to host before-they're-famous indie-rock bands alongside the occasional anti-comedian and film screening. Mondays are usually no cover.

    http://www.verticalwinebistro.com Probably the swankest wine bar in Old Town Pasadena, this high-design joint juts from a hidden courtyard on Raymond’s restaurant row, all subdued lighting and gleaming surfaces and hidden corners. You will never, never feel out of place in an LBD or a pinstriped Thom Browne suit here, or lack for well-heeled admirers. But Vertical is more ambitious than that: It aspires to be nothing less than the Pasadena equivalent of A.O.C., with zillions of wines available by the taste, the glass, the bottle and the flight — three side-by-side Williams Selyem pinot noirs, for example, or New Zealand sauvignon blancs, or Argentine malbecs. Vertical is a showcase of artisanal cheeses and cured meats, Serrano-ham-wrapped date poppers and meaty, grape-friendly small dishes, and duck confit with mustard greens. If you would rather look into the depths of a Barolo-braised brisket than into the eyes of an attractive stranger, at Vertical it can always be arranged.
